Output 8ef635104b9c0439b56202ae98d84eb7d9f04dc6aa944672d509c608f3aba1fd:1

value
331640690
script pubkey
OP_0 OP_PUSHBYTES_20 d525c321524d3aa8259d82dbe35c8a6a155f72f6
address
ltc1q65juxg2jf5a2sfvastd7xhy2dg247uhka8222p
transaction
8ef635104b9c0439b56202ae98d84eb7d9f04dc6aa944672d509c608f3aba1fd
spent
true